Structure feature
1. On-off no abrasion: Ball rotates after departure from seat, so that can eliminate the sealing surfaces abrasion, to solve the abrasion problems about traditional ball valve seat sealing surface and balls.
2. Torque operation: Due to there is no friction between seat and ball, its very easy for stem operation. Therefore we usually use hand wheel operation for ball valve instead of worm gear operation and others except the big size ball valves.
3. Single-seat design: The static single-seat valve installation can ensure bi-directional zero leakage, and avoid the problem of cavity pressure increase in double-seat valve.
4. Anti-wear hard sealing face: Bead welding ball with a layer of hard alloy steel and polished to meet the harsh working condition with reliable sealing performance.
5. Self-cleaning: When the ball separate from the seat, the fluid in pipeline will flow through the ball equally along the sphere sealing surface degree 360. Not only eliminated the partial erosion by high-speed fluid on valve seat, but also washed away the accumulation substances on the surface, then come to purpose of self-cleaning, eliminating the effect of accumulation to seal performance.
6. Top entry type: Top entry ball and seat design, so we can check and maintain without disassembling the body in the line.
7. Seat sealing face metal protection: Strengthened PTFE corrugated with metal seat, so that the seat metal sealing surface can get the good protection.
8. Wedge-shaped seal structure: The mechanical force of valve is provided by stem, force the ball on the seat and then sealed. So the valve sealing performance is not influenced by pipeline pressure. Therefore, make the sealing performance reliable in various conditions.
